actix-jwt-authc

Crates.io docs.rs Continuous integration Coverage Status

JWT authentication middleware for Actix that supports checking for invalidated JWTs without paying the cost of a per-request IO call. It sources invalidated JWTs from a Stream and stores them in memory.

This middleware is based on the assumption that since JWTs (should) have an expiry, ultimately, an in-memory set of explicitly-invalidated-yet-unexpired JWTs that are periodically reloaded should not be overwhelmingly big enough to cause problems. Only testing can truly answer if this assumption works for a given usecase.

Example

The example included in this repo has

  • A simple set of routes for starting and inspecting the current session
  • An in-memory implementation of the invalidated JWT interface
    • In-memory loop for purging expired JWTs from the store
    • Channel-based Stream of invalidated JWT events for powering the invalidated JWT set used by the middleware
  • ring to generate an Ed25519 keypair for EdDSA-signed JWTs

Both session and JWT keys are generated on the fly, so JWTs are incompatible across restarts.

It supports tracing and session as features. To run a server on 8080:

cargo run --example inmemory --features tracing,session

Supported endpoints

  • /login to start a session
  • /logout to destroy the current session (requires a session)
  • /session to inspect the current session (requires a session)
  • /maybe_sesion to inspect the current session if it exists

If session is not passed, authentication in the example is dependent on Bearer tokens sent as an Authorization header.
